#include <audio/audio.h>
#include <audio/Aproto.h>
#include "os.h"
#include "osdep.h"
#undef NULL
#include <stdio.h>
#include <audio/Aos.h>

#ifndef PATH_MAX
#ifdef MAXPATHLEN
#define PATH_MAX MAXPATHLEN
#else
#define PATH_MAX 1024
#endif
#endif

#if !defined(SYSV) && !defined(AMOEBA) && !defined(_MINIX)
#include <sys/resource.h>
#endif

#ifndef ADMPATH
#define ADMPATH "/usr/adm/X%smsgs"
#endif

extern char *display;
#ifdef RLIMIT_DATA
int limitDataSpace = -1;
#endif
#ifdef RLIMIT_STACK
int limitStackSpace = -1;
#endif
#ifdef RLIMIT_NOFILE
int limitNoFile = -1;
#endif

OsInit()
{
#ifndef AMOEBA
    static Bool been_here = FALSE;
    char fname[PATH_MAX];

#ifdef macII
    set42sig();
#endif

    if (!been_here) {
#if !defined(SCO) && !defined(__386BSD__)
	fclose(stdin);
	fclose(stdout);
#endif
	/* hack test to decide where to log errors */
	if (write (2, fname, 0)) 
	{
	    FILE *err;
	    sprintf (fname, ADMPATH, display);
	    /*
	     * uses stdio to avoid os dependencies here,
	     * a real os would use
 	     *  open (fname, O_WRONLY|O_APPEND|O_CREAT, 0666)
	     */
	    if (!(err = fopen (fname, "a+")))
		err = fopen ("/dev/null", "w");
	    if (err && (fileno(err) != 2)) {
		dup2 (fileno (err), 2);
		fclose (err);
	    }
#if defined(SYSV) || defined(SVR4) || defined(AMOEBA) || defined(_MINIX)
	    {
	    static char buf[BUFSIZ];
	    setvbuf (stderr, buf, _IOLBF, BUFSIZ);
	    }
#else
	    setlinebuf(stderr);
#endif
	}

#ifndef X_NOT_POSIX
	if (getpgrp () == 0)
	    setpgid (0, 0);
#else
#ifndef SYSV
	if (getpgrp (0) == 0)
	    setpgrp (0, getpid ());
#endif
#endif

#ifdef RLIMIT_DATA
	if (limitDataSpace >= 0)
	{
	    struct rlimit	rlim;

	    if (!getrlimit(RLIMIT_DATA, &rlim))
	    {
		if ((limitDataSpace > 0) && (limitDataSpace < rlim.rlim_max))
		    rlim.rlim_cur = limitDataSpace;
		else
		    rlim.rlim_cur = rlim.rlim_max;
		(void)setrlimit(RLIMIT_DATA, &rlim);
	    }
	}
#endif
#ifdef RLIMIT_STACK
	if (limitStackSpace >= 0)
	{
	    struct rlimit	rlim;

	    if (!getrlimit(RLIMIT_STACK, &rlim))
	    {
		if ((limitStackSpace > 0) && (limitStackSpace < rlim.rlim_max))
		    rlim.rlim_cur = limitStackSpace;
		else
		    rlim.rlim_cur = rlim.rlim_max;
		(void)setrlimit(RLIMIT_STACK, &rlim);
	    }
	}
#endif
#ifdef RLIMIT_NOFILE
	if (limitNoFile >= 0)
	{
	    struct rlimit	rlim;

	    if (!getrlimit(RLIMIT_NOFILE, &rlim))
	    {
		if ((limitNoFile > 0) && (limitNoFile < rlim.rlim_max))
		    rlim.rlim_cur = limitNoFile;
		else
		    rlim.rlim_cur = rlim.rlim_max;
		if (rlim.rlim_cur > MAXSOCKS)
		    rlim.rlim_cur = MAXSOCKS;
		(void)setrlimit(RLIMIT_NOFILE, &rlim);
	    }
	}
#endif
	been_here = TRUE;
#endif /* AMOEBA */
    }
    OsInitAllocator();
}
